An injury to potential top selection Joel Embiid of Cameroon is just one of many question marks facing NBA teams as they try to find future stars in Thursday's draft. A talent-laden 2014 draft class includes a number of promising international players, with 18-year-old Australian guard Dante Exum perhaps the most intriguing. Unlike Embiid, who played one year at the University of Kansas before declaring for the draft, Exum hasn't played at a US college, lessening the chance that the athletic and intelligent 6-foot, 6-inch (1.98 m) youngster will be taken with the first overall pick by the Cleveland Cavaliers. Embiid, who broke the Jayhawks' freshman record with 72 blocked shots and was the Big 12 conference's Defensive Player of the Year for Kansas, had been widely tipped as a likely top pick before he needed surgery last week that used two screws to stabilize a stress fracture in his right foot.
